Tessalit vs Santis Climate & Distance Between

Switzerland flag
  • The distance between Tessalit, Mali and Santis, Switzerland is approximately 3,101 km or 1,927 mi.
  • To reach Tessalit in this distance one would set out from Santis bearing 197° or SSW and follow the great circles arc to approach Tessalit bearing 192.2° or SSW .
  • Tessalit has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h) whereas Santis has a tundra climate (ET).
  • Tessalit is in or near the tropical desert biome whereas Santis is in or near the cool temperate wet forest biome.
  • The mean annual temperature is 30.4 °C (54.7°F) warmer.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 2.7 °C (4.9°F) more in Tessalit.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ic for both.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 2834.5 mm (111.6 in) less which is equivalent to 2834.5 l/m² (69.57 US gal/ft²) or 28,345,000 l/ha (3,030,269 US gal/ac) less. About 0 as much.
  • There are 1696 more hours of sunlight per year in Tessalit. In whichever way circa 4h 38' more per day or about 2 as many.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 26.2° higher in Tessalit than in Santis.
  • Relative humidity levels are 58% lower.
  • The mean dew point temperature is 6.8°C (12.2°F) higher.
